Naming is among the initial and most subsidiary decisions parents do to the child. This act has spiritual and moral implications in Islam. A good name does not only represent identity, but also values, character, and connection with Islamic tradition. Although the Islamic teaching favors name with positive meanings and good backgrounds names, there are those who relate names to the day or date of birth of the child. This concept, however, is not guided by Islamic principles.
